On April 19, 2018, the Board of Commissioners authorized the Director of Procurement and Materials Management to issue a purchase order and enter into an agreement for Contract 18-RFP-06 Legal Services for Workers’ Compensation Defense for the period of June 1, 2018 through May 31, 2020 with the option to extend for an additional one-year period, with Dennis Noble and Associates, P.C., in an amount not to exceed $225,000.00 (Purchase Order 3099776), and Nyhan, Bambrick, Kinzie & Lowry, P.C., in an amount not to exceed $150,000.00 (Purchase Order 3099775).

 

As of November 20, 2019, the attached list of change orders has been approved. There were two change orders for Dennis Noble & Associates, P.C. The net effect of these change orders resulted in an increase of $19,667.89, from the original amount awarded of $225,000.00, which resulted in an 8.74% increase of the original value of the purchase order for a revised contract value of $224,667.89. There was one change order for Nyhan, Bambrick, Kinzie & Lowry, P.C. resulting in a decrease in an amount of $35,936.40, from an original amount awarded of $150,000.00, which resulted in a 23.96% decrease of the original value of the purchase order for a contract value of $114,063.60.

 

These change orders are required for continued legal representation on workers’ compensation cases. Additional funds are needed to continue the representation by Dennis Noble & Associates, P.C. and by Nyhan, Bambrick, Kinzie & Lowry, P.C. for the twelve (12) month period from June 1, 2020 to May 31, 2021. Services to be provided by legal counsel include advice and counsel on disputed and litigated claims, processing of pro se settlements, and representation before arbitrators at the Illinois Workers’ Compensation Commission and on appeals.

 

These change orders are in compliance with the Illinois Criminal Code since the changes are germane to the contract.

 

It is hereby recommended that the Board of Commissioners authorize the Director of Procurement and Materials Management to execute change orders to increase the purchase orders and to extend the agreements for Contract 18-RFP-06 with Dennis Noble & Associates, P.C., in the amount of $90,000.00 (36.78% of the current value), from an amount of $244,667.89, to an amount not to exceed $334,667.89, and with Nyhan, Bambrick, Kinzie & Lowry, P.C., in an amount of $60,000.00 (52.60% of the current value), from an amount of $114,063.60, to an amount not to exceed $174,063.60 for the twelve (12) month period from June 1, 2020 to May 31, 2021.

 

The additional estimated expenditures for years 2020 and 2021 for Dennis Noble & Associates, P.C. are $52,500.00 and $37,500.00, respectively. The additional estimated expenditures for years 2020 and 2021 for Nyhan, Bambrick, Kinzie & Lowry, P.C. are $35,000.00 and $25,000.00, respectively.

 

Funds for the 2020 expenditures in the amount of $87,500.00 are available in Account 101-25000-612430. Funds for 2021 expenditures in the amount of $62,500.00 are contingent on the Board of Commissioners’ approval of the District’s budget for that year.
